Every country has its limits. One of those limits, for one country, is on display in this study:

Mismatch between jar opening demands and wrist torque strength of consumers in Iran,” Iman Dianat, Behzad Asadi, Héctor Ignacio Castellucci, Applied Ergonomics, vol. 94, March 2021, article 103421. The authors report:

“A considerable mismatch (range = 25%–100%) was found between the required torque strength for opening the existing jars and the wrist U/R torque strength of the study population, particularly for females and those aged 5–9 years. A torque limit of 1.8 Nm was proposed for opening jars for the entire population.”
